Urban redevelopment is a critical process that involves revitalizing and improving existing urban areas to meet the evolving needs of the community. In countries like Ukraine and Israel, urban redevelopment projects play a significant role in shaping the future of cities and enhancing the quality of life for residents. In this blog post, we will explore the latest news and updates on urban redevelopment initiatives in Ukraine and Israel. **Ukraine:** In recent years, Ukraine has witnessed a growing focus on urban redevelopment as a means to address issues such as decaying infrastructure, housing shortages, and environmental challenges. One of the most notable urban redevelopment projects in Ukraine is the revitalization of historic districts in cities like Kyiv and Lviv. These projects aim to preserve the architectural heritage of these cities while modernizing infrastructure and improving living conditions for residents. Another key aspect of urban redevelopment in Ukraine is the promotion of sustainable and green development practices. Initiatives such as the implementation of energy-efficient technologies, green spaces, and pedestrian-friendly infrastructure are gaining momentum across various cities in Ukraine. These efforts not only contribute to environmental conservation but also create healthier and more vibrant urban environments for residents. **Israel:** In Israel, urban redevelopment is a key strategy for addressing the challenges posed by rapid population growth and urbanization. The country has been actively promoting urban renewal projects in cities like Tel Aviv, Jerusalem, and Haifa to revitalize underdeveloped areas and create more livable spaces for residents. These projects often involve the renovation of old buildings, the development of mixed-use complexes, and the enhancement of public infrastructure. One of the noteworthy urban redevelopment initiatives in Israel is the conversion of industrial zones into modern residential and commercial hubs. By repurposing obsolete industrial areas, Israel is able to meet the growing demand for housing and office spaces in urban centers while preserving the historical character of these locations. **Latest News and Updates:** In both Ukraine and Israel, urban redevelopment continues to be a dynamic and evolving process.
